The free trial content is being expanded from the first half of the base game to include all the base game plus the first expansion. That's a large, very good slice of the game you can play for free without buying anything.

If you're not geared up heavily that 500 is pretty nice. If you are... yeah it's not much - 10 handins at max gets more than that. But that would be mind-numbing to do without a macro... level 70 handins you can Trained Eye at 80 to hit max quality in one shot and hammer them out really fast.
They do use a lot of mats, but the nodes for the special mats for restoration like to randomly give you anywhere from +2 to +9 mats per swing, plus copious +1 swing (on which you should pop your +2 per swing skill). So it actually doesn't take THAT long to gather a massive pile of them (use the ground markers so you don't have to keep re-finding them). The fourth material is always something normal, but it's usually just 1 of a processed material.
If you don't have a level 80 crafter... this is definitely going to be slower, and you probably want to look at getting one (though you'll want to at least be able to do the level 70 handins probably for that).
